Use ERR_CAST function instead of ERR_PTR and PTR_ERR.
Patch found using coccinelle.

Signed-off-by: Alexandru Gheorghiu <gheorghiuan...@gmail.com>
---
 drivers/usb/gadget/composite.c |    2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/usb/gadget/composite.c b/drivers/usb/gadget/composite.c
index 7c821de..5b73a74 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/gadget/composite.c
+++ b/drivers/usb/gadget/composite.c
@@ -1138,7 +1138,7 @@ struct usb_string *usb_gstrings_attach(struct 
usb_composite_dev *cdev,
 
        uc = copy_gadget_strings(sp, n_gstrings, n_strings);
        if (IS_ERR(uc))
-               return ERR_PTR(PTR_ERR(uc));
+               return ERR_CAST(uc);
 
        n_gs = get_containers_gs(uc);
        ret = usb_string_ids_tab(cdev, n_gs[0]->strings);
